This week, The Buzz presents a recording from ACT-IAC's archives.

ACT-IAC's 2020 CX Summit occurred in a particularly challenging year for customer experience. COVID-19  spotlighted the gaps in agencies where progress hadn't happened.  while also highlighting agencies where those improvements had already been made.

The virtual event was closed out by a fireside chat between Kathy Conrad and Robert Shea. They discussed Robert's role in the Presidential Election Project, how to expand the focus on CX, how to measure progress, how to improve trust in governance and how to shift to digital access.

Kathy Conrad
is the Director of Digital Government at Accenture Federal Services

Robert Shea is the National Managing Principal of Public Policy at Grant Thornton Public Sector
